Production Details
The Scorpion follows Kit (O’Hara), a struggling young woman whose dream of launching her own clothing line has stalled. Desperate for money, she accepts a mysterious job at a cutting-edge cosmetics lab that claims to have eliminated animal testing in favor of willing human participants. As Kit becomes increasingly entangled in the lab’s bizarre experiments — involving perfumes, chemicals, and invasive procedures — her life begins to improve, even as disturbing physical and psychological changes begin to surface.

About The Scorpion
The Scorpion tells the story of Kit, a young woman intent on starting her own clothing line. Facing challenges in pursuing her passion, she takes a job at a forward-thinking cosmetics lab that promotes human participation over animal testing. As Kit delves deeper into her role, she is drawn into unusual experiments that blur the lines of ethics and safety.
While her professional life takes a turn for the better, the unconventional methods of the lab lead to troubling changes in Kit’s health and psyche. The film explores themes of ambition, morality, and the consequences of innovation in the beauty industry.
